How to get Nick Fury Fortnite bundle

Fortnite S.H.I.E.L.D. Set Items

Nick Fury is the director of the organization S.H.I.E.L.D and works closely with the Avengers. Epic Games added his outfit to the Fortnite Item Shop on November 26, and you can also get the S.H.I.E.L.D Set.

Here’s everything in the S.H.I.E.L.D Set:

  • Nick Fury outfit
  • F.I.E.L.D Pack Back Bling 
  • Director’s Scythe Pickaxe 
  • First-Strike Infiltration Glider
  • Quinjets in Flight Loading Screen

Fury has played a major role in the Marvel Cinematic Universe movies, and his Fortnite skin is based on his appearance in those. The Back Bling is included with the outfit, but you’ll have to purchase the Pickaxe and Glider separately.

Fortnite Nick Fury bundle price

Fortnite Nick Fury bundle

Nick Fury’s outfit and Back Bling bundle cost 1,500 V-Bucks while the Glider and Pickaxe cost 800 V-Bucks each. Alternatively, you could spring for the whole S.H.I.E.L.D set for just 2,000 V-Bucks.

This costs the same as a Legendary skin includes all of these items, making it one of the cheapest bundles in the game. You can then equip the Nick Fury outfit as you battle Sideways Cube Monsters.
